Prefrontal Cortex

The front part of the frontal lobes of the brain, involved in complex behaviors including planning, decision making, and moderating social behavior.

Conditioned Stimulus

A previously neutral stimulus that, after being associated with an unconditioned stimulus, eventually triggers a conditioned response.

Unconditioned Response

An automatic, natural reaction to a stimulus that occurs without any need for learning or previous experience.
